I had worked with glass sculpture before but assembled them using outside brackets, but this one hangs on a wall and I wanted a much cleaner appearance. All during the painting phase, I did a lot of research to get ideas of how of how I was going to assemble this. I decided to use an industrial strength adhesive to keep a clean look. I also used black nylon bearings that are used in robotics as the stand-offs. Everything is glued together with the adhesive. There isn’t a single nut, bolt, screw, nail, or staple in it. Another challenge was how was I going to hang this. I figured out I could use the adhesive here as well, to glue two D-clips to the back and string a wire to hang the sculpture. It worked out very well. |
